Stop #1: Branson, Missouri
If music and entertainment are your thing, you can't miss Branson. With more than 50 theaters, Branson is known as the "Live Music Capital of the World." But the city also boasts beautiful lakes, golf courses, and museums.
Stop #2: Mammoth Cave National Park, Kentucky
Mammoth Cave National Park is the longest known cave system in the world, with over 400 miles of explored underground passageways. In addition to the cave tours, the park offers hiking trails, horseback riding, and canoeing on the Green River.
Stop #3: Asheville, North Carolina
Asheville is an artsy, vibrant city nestled in the Blue Ridge Mountains. Visit the historic Biltmore Estate, enjoy craft beer at one of Asheville's many breweries, or explore the quirky boutiques and galleries in the downtown area.
Stop #4: Shenandoah National Park, Virginia
Stretching for 105 miles along the Blue Ridge Mountains, Shenandoah National Park is a paradise for outdoor enthusiasts. With dozens of hiking trails, campgrounds, and picnic areas, this park is the perfect place to disconnect and immerse yourself in nature.
Stop #5: Monticello, Virginia
Monticello was the home of Thomas Jefferson, the third president of the United States. This UNESCO World Heritage site offers guided tours of the mansion and gardens, as well as exhibits about Jefferson's life and legacy.
